Output 81b6f865dc6c909c978102e8b659b54621210270192800b9a68c81cb68415689:25

value
367500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7ef1a6625fa4733e8bbca66ab3fc79f8b64b9943 OP_EQUAL
address
3DGEYr3msU9QfgniB6U3D5uqduSY8Cx161
transaction
81b6f865dc6c909c978102e8b659b54621210270192800b9a68c81cb68415689
spent
true